THE JOB

As an Emergency Veterinarian at VEG, you will be responsible for handling a wide range of emergency cases, from routine to complex surgeries, and treating all types of pets, including exotic species. Your role involves answering medical questions over the phone, seeing patients immediately, conducting physical examinations, and communicating with clients about diagnoses and treatment plans. You will also perform minor and major emergency surgeries, endoscopic procedures, and provide education on aftercare and preventative measures.
